Ko Khai is a small island in the middle of the two major islands, Ko Tarutao
and Ko Adang-Rawi. This beautiful island is very unique with a large stone
archway made by nature. The sandy beach here has the co lour of eggshell,
and it is also the turtle’s egg-laying site; there are reasons why the
island is call Ko Khai, which means “egg island”.
However, it is prohibited to stay overnight on this island, and
there is no freshwater here.
Very near Ko Khai is another island named Ko Klang. This island is
comparatively larger and is full of wild forests, but there are no beaches
at all.
Location: between Ko Tarutao and Ko Adang-Rawi, around 15
kilometers away from Ko Tarutao.
